Description
In reads of very large data series, it is common to run into ulimits.
One convinient way to support scripting that we could offer is to implement a user-facing option on how many iterations to not call .close()
on when opening a new iteration in non-streaming read mode.
That way, we could clean up the oldest iterations we opened when opening a new one while looping through series for analysis and the user does not need to keep track. Such an option would also make it simpler for openPMD-viewer et al. to implement iterations through series.
